Downing Street is once again gaining a new resident. The safe money is on Andy Burnham – former Manchester Mayor, newly elected MP, and the frontrunner to become our next Prime Minister.

The challenges he inherits are significant. Economic growth is weak, business confidence is low, and unemployment is historically high. But there are 4.4 million self-employed people in the UK who have very little idea where they stand in what comes next.

We've heard positive noises from Burnham on employer's National Insurance, business rates and the personal allowance. But what's less clear is whether the self-employed will have a proper, recognised place in his government's plans for the economy and the labour market.

Join IPSE's Managing Director, Vicks Rodwell, and Head of Policy and Research, Josh Toovey, for a frank look at what the last two years of Labour government have and haven't delivered for the self-employed, and what we want to see from whoever moves into No. 10.

What we will be covering:

  • The Labour record: what has actually changed for contractors and freelancers since July 2024, and what was promised but never delivered
  • What we want from day one: the immediate steps a new government could take to make self-employment easier
  • Late payment: legislation is moving through Parliament. Will it actually shift the dial for freelancers waiting on invoices?
  • IR35 and employment status: where things stand, what is still broken, and what needs to change
  • Making Tax Digital: awareness levels and what we’re calling for
  • Parental leave: the government's review is ongoing but will government still be willing to act?
